Understanding the Significance of Oxford Circus

So, why is Oxford Circus such a focal point for news? Guys, it's more than just a busy intersection; it's a true nexus of London life. Geographically, it's where Oxford Street, Regent Street, and Bond Street converge, making it a critical hub for retail, entertainment, and, of course, transportation. Millions of people pass through here every single week. Think about it – it's home to flagship stores that draw shoppers from all over the globe, iconic theatres that light up the West End, and it serves as a vital interchange for multiple Tube lines, including the Central, Victoria, and Bakerloo lines. This constant flow of people and activity means that any changes, announcements, or incidents in Oxford Circus have a ripple effect across the city. Major retail news, like the opening or closing of a significant store, always makes headlines. Similarly, any disruptions to the Underground services here can cause widespread travel chaos. Transport and Travel Updates Affecting Oxford Circus

Alright guys, let's get down to the nitty-gritty: transport and travel updates that directly impact navigating around Oxford Circus. This area is a major transport node, and any news here can seriously affect your daily commute or a weekend shopping trip. The Oxford Circus Underground station is one of the busiest in London, serving the Central, Victoria, and Bakerloo lines. Because of its importance, TfL often carries out upgrade works or maintenance that might lead to temporary closures of platforms, station entrances/exits, or even line suspensions during off-peak hours or weekends. You’ll want to check the latest TfL advisories before you head out, especially if you rely on this station. News about potential overcrowding also frequently surrounds Oxford Circus, particularly during peak shopping seasons or major events. TfL sometimes implements measures to manage the flow of passengers, which can include asking people to use alternative stations or even temporarily holding trains. Bus routes are another critical element. Numerous bus routes pass through or terminate at Oxford Circus, connecting it to all corners of London. Updates regarding bus diversions due to roadworks, special events, or traffic incidents are common. For instance, any news about the ongoing pedestrianisation or traffic restrictions on Oxford Street and surrounding roads will directly influence bus routes and travel times. It’s always a good idea to check live bus information apps or TfL’s website for real-time updates. Beyond public transport, cyclists and pedestrians also need to be aware of changes. TfL has been working on improving cycle infrastructure across central London, and updates might include new cycle lanes or changes to existing routes that affect access to Oxford Circus.
